What Are Best Upsell Plugin for WooCommerce (Expert Comparison)
Table of Contents
- Introduction
- What Is the Upsell Plugin for WooCommerce?
- Role of a WooCommerce Upsell Plugin In the WooCommerce
- How to Choose the Best Upsell Plugin for Your WooCommerce Store
- List of 5 Best Upsell Plugins for WooCommerce for Better Sales
- Common Problems with WooCommerce Upsell Plugins and Simple Fixes
- Conclusion
Introduction
Upselling helps you earn more from the same customers. It works by showing a better product option to buyers. Many store owners use a WooCommerce upsell plugin for this goal. You can also offer helpful add-ons before checkout. This improves cart value without forcing extra ads. The best upsell plugin for WooCommerce makes this process simple. It helps you show the right offer at the right time.
It also keeps the buying journey smooth and fast. A good upsell plugin WooCommerce users trust should be easy. It should not confuse shoppers or slow pages down. You can use upsells on product, cart, or checkout screens. When used well, upsells feel like helpful suggestions. That is why choosing the best WooCommerce upsell plugin matters.
In this guide, you will learn what upsell plugins do. You will also learn how they work inside WooCommerce stores.
What Is the Upsell Plugin for WooCommerce?
A WooCommerce upsell plugin is a tool that shows upgrade offers. It helps you suggest higher value items during shopping. It can also recommend related items as smart add-ons. Many tools also work as a WooCommerce upsell and cross sell plugin. That means they can suggest upgrades and extra items together. An upsell shows a better version of the same item.
A cross sell shows a related item that fits the cart. A WooCommerce product upsell plugin can use rules for offers. For example, it can show premium options in the product page. It can also show bundles in the cart page area. Some plugins also add order bumps at checkout. Order bumps are small add-ons near the payment button. Some plugins also show post purchase offers after checkout. These offers can appear on the thank you page too. The best upsell plugin for WooCommerce lets you choose placements. It also lets you control when offers appear.
A strong WooCommerce upsell plugin helps you target better. You can target by product, category, cart total, or user type. This keeps offers relevant and improves conversions. When offers match the buyer’s needs, sales rise naturally. This is why many stores call it the best WooCommerce upsell plugin.
Role of a WooCommerce Upsell Plugin In the WooCommerce
- Increase average order value without extra ad spend. It helps you earn more per customer purchase easily. It shows upgrades and add-ons during the same checkout flow. This is why many stores use a WooCommerce upsell plugin daily.
- Show upgrade offers at the right shopping stage. It can display upgrades on product pages and cart pages. It can also display order bumps at checkout for quick adds. The best upsell plugin for WooCommerce supports flexible placements.
- Improve product discovery and reduce buyer confusion. It highlights better options and clear value differences. This helps customers pick the right item faster. A WooCommerce product upsell plugin can guide choices smoothly.
- Combine upsells and cross-sells in one system. Many tools work as a WooCommerce upsell and cross sell plugin. You can suggest a premium item and matching add-ons together. This makes recommendations feel more relevant and natural.
- Automate offers using smart rules and conditions. You can target by cart value, category, or user role. You can also exclude products to avoid repeat offers. A strong upsell plugin WooCommerce stores trust saves time.
- Boost conversions with relevant offers, not random products. Better targeting keeps offers helpful and not annoying. This improves acceptance rates and keeps shoppers happy. That is a key sign of the best WooCommerce upsell plugin.
How to Choose the Best Upsell Plugin for Your WooCommerce Store
- Decide the best upsell placement for your store first. Choose product page, cart page, checkout, or post-purchase offers. Each placement supports different goals and store types. A WooCommerce upsell plugin should match your priority areas.
- Check if it supports order bumps and post-purchase upsells. Order bumps add small items right at checkout fast. Post-purchase upsells add offers after payment is completed. If you need funnels, choose the best upsell plugin for WooCommerce.
- Look for strong rule-based targeting and offer conditions. You should target by product, category, and cart amount. You should also target by user role and purchase history. A WooCommerce product upsell plugin must keep offers relevant.
- Confirm compatibility with your theme, builder, and checkout setup. Some plugins conflict with custom checkout layouts and blocks. Test it on staging to avoid checkout errors. A stable WooCommerce upsell plugin protects your sales flow.
- Check speed impact and keep the store fast. Heavy recommendation engines can slow product and cart pages. Choose a plugin that loads offers without delays. The best WooCommerce upsell plugin should stay lightweight.
- Review reporting, tracking, and conversion insights offered. Basic reports show offer views, clicks, and accepted offers. Advanced tools show funnel steps and revenue per offer. This helps you improve your upsell plugin WooCommerce performance.
- Compare pricing, license limits, and needed features carefully. Some features are locked behind higher plans and add-ons. Pick a plan that fits your store size and goals. Your best upsell plugin for WooCommerce should be worth it.
- Make sure it supports both upsell and cross-sell strategy. Stores often need upgrades plus add-on suggestions together. A WooCommerce upsell and cross sell plugin helps you cover both. This builds a complete offer system for your store.
List of 5 Best Upsell Plugins for WooCommerce for Better Sales
#1 FunnelKit: Best Upsell Plugin for WooCommerce
FunnelKit is a powerful WooCommerce upsell plugin for store growth. It is best when you want post-purchase upsells and funnel steps. It helps you show a one-click offer after the payment completes. This keeps the buyer in a buying mindset and reduces friction. Many store owners choose it as the best WooCommerce upsell plugin for funnels.
It also supports order bumps that appear during checkout. You can build simple or advanced flows without coding skills. If you want a clean upsell plugin WooCommerce system, FunnelKit fits well. It works best for stores that want structured offers and better conversion flow.
Features
- One-click post-purchase upsells and downsells in one flow.
- Checkout order bumps for quick add-on offers.
- Funnel steps with offer pages and thank you page control.
- Rule-based targeting for showing offers to the right buyers.
- Revenue tracking for upsell performance and accepted offers.
Pros
- Strong post-purchase funnel features for higher order value.
- Clean user experience with smooth one-click offer acceptance.
- Flexible rules for targeting by cart and product conditions.
- Works well for stores that need advanced sales funnels.
- Helps build a full WooCommerce upsell and cross sell plugin flow.
Cons
- Funnel setup can take time for new store owners.
- Some features may need higher plan access.
- Too many offers can confuse users if not planned.
- Not ideal if you only need simple product page upsells.
- May require testing with your checkout and gateway setup.
Download: FunnelKit
#2 CartFlows Upsell Plugin for Checkout Control
CartFlows is a popular WooCommerce upsell plugin focused on checkout flow. It helps you build custom steps for checkout and sales pages. It is a strong choice when you want to order bumps and upsells. It also supports post-purchase offers with a structured funnel approach. Many store owners call it the best upsell plugin for WooCommerce for checkout improvements.
It can replace a basic checkout with a cleaner conversion layout. You can create step-by-step journeys for different product types. It also works well as a WooCommerce upsell and cross sell plugin setup. If your store needs better checkout structure, CartFlows is a solid fit.
Features
- Custom checkout flows with step-based funnel structure.
- Order bumps at checkout for quick add-on items.
- One-click upsells after purchase for higher conversions.
- Ready templates for faster funnel setup and launch.
- Page builder support for designing checkout and offers.
Pros
- Great checkout customization for better conversion rates.
- Good funnel building options for upsells and add-ons.
- Templates help beginners create flows faster.
- Works well for product, cart, and checkout offer strategy.
- Supports a strong upsell plugin WooCommerce workflow overall.
Cons
- Advanced features are mostly in the paid version.
- Setup needs planning to avoid too many funnel steps.
- Checkout changes can conflict with some themes sometimes.
- Can feel heavy if you only need one upsell block.
- Requires good testing before using on a live store.
Download: CartFlows
#3 UpsellWP Upsell Plugin for Simple Store Offers
UpsellWP is a beginner-friendly WooCommerce upsell plugin with clean options. It helps you add product page upsells and cart recommendations fast. It also supports checkout order bumps in many store setups. Many users choose it as the best WooCommerce upsell plugin for simple use.
It works well when you want quick offers without complex funnels. It can also act like a WooCommerce upsell and cross sell plugin. You can suggest higher versions of products and related add-ons. The plugin focuses on simple setup and store friendly layouts. If you need an easy upsell plugin WooCommerce solution, UpsellWP is a strong choice.
Features
- Product page upsells for upgrades and higher value choices.
- Cart page offers for add-ons and related products.
- Checkout order bumps for quick extra item sales.
- Frequently bought together style suggestions for bundle style sales.
- Simple rules to control when offers appear on pages.
Pros
- Easy setup without complex funnel planning needed.
- Clean design that fits most WooCommerce store layouts.
- Supports multiple upsell placements across store pages.
- Great for beginners who want fast results.
- Works as a good WooCommerce upsell and cross sell plugin option.
Cons
- Not as advanced as full funnel tools for post-purchase.
- Reporting may be basic depending on your plan.
- Advanced targeting can be limited for large stores.
- Some features require premium plan access.
- Best results need careful offer selection and testing.
Download: UpsellWP
#4 WooCommerce Product Recommendations
WooCommerce Product Recommendations is an official WooCommerce extension. It works like a smart engine for showing product suggestions. It is best when you want rule-based offers and targeting. It can recommend products based on cart items and store logic. Many stores choose it as the best upsell plugin for WooCommerce for automation.
It helps you create recommendation engines for different pages. You can show suggestions on product pages and cart pages. It also supports advanced conditions for better relevance. If you want a controlled WooCommerce product upsell plugin, this is strong. It fits stores that want smart offers without full funnel steps.
Features
- Recommendation engines based on rules and product filters.
- Targeting by cart contents, categories, and purchase patterns.
- Display options for product, cart, and related offer areas.
- Sorting controls for best sellers, price, or rating.
- Official WooCommerce extension support and compatibility focus.
Pros
- Strong rule-based targeting for smart product suggestions.
- Built for WooCommerce and fits official extension ecosystem.
- Helps automate recommendations across multiple store areas.
- Great for stores with large catalogs and many categories.
- Works as a powerful WooCommerce upsell plugin for automation.
Cons
- Not focused on one-click post-purchase upsell funnels.
- Needs time to build engines and set rules properly.
- Requires paid extension access for full use.
- May need testing to avoid irrelevant suggestions.
- Not ideal if you want simple plug and play offers.
Download: WooCommerce Product Recommendations
#5 One Click Upsell Funnel for WooCommerce
One Click Upsell Funnel for WooCommerce is a budget-friendly option. It helps you set up upsell funnels with simple steps. It is useful for small stores that want quick upsell testing. It can create offers that appear after a customer buys. It also supports add-ons that match cart items and products.
Many store owners try it when they need a WooCommerce upsell plugin fast. It works well when you want basic funnels without heavy tools. It can also support cross-sell style suggestions in the process. If you want a starter upsell plugin WooCommerce stores can afford, this can help.
Features
- Basic upsell funnels with post-purchase offer steps.
- Offer rules for matching products and cart conditions.
- Add-on offers that work as cross-sells in many cases.
- Simple setup flow for fast upsell launch.
- Works as a starter WooCommerce product upsell plugin option.
Pros
- Good for testing upsells with a lower budget.
- Simple setup for small stores and new users.
- Helps create basic funnel offers without complex tools.
- Can support a WooCommerce upsell and cross sell plugin strategy.
- Useful entry option before moving to advanced funnel plugins.
Cons
- Features may be limited for advanced store needs.
- Reporting and tracking can be basic in many setups.
- Design control may be limited depending on plan.
- May not match enterprise level funnel requirements.
- You must test carefully with your checkout and gateway.
Download: One Click Upsell Funnel for WooCommerce
Common Problems with WooCommerce Upsell Plugins and Simple Fixes
- Upsell offers are not showing on product or cart pages. Check the plugin placement settings and page display options. Make sure the rule conditions match the selected products correctly. Confirm the product status is published and in stock. Clear cache and test again in a private browser window. A WooCommerce upsell plugin will not show offers if rules fail.
- Checkout order bump does not appear during checkout. Confirm you are using the correct checkout page template. Some themes override checkout layouts and hide plugin blocks. Disable checkout customization plugins to test conflicts quickly. Switch to a default theme for a short test run. Then re-enable items one by one to find issues. This helps your upsell plugin WooCommerce setup stay stable.
- Upsell plugin slows down the store pages and cart loads. Too many widgets can increase load time and script calls. Reduce the number of offers shown on one page. Turn off unused modules inside the WooCommerce upsell plugin settings. Use caching and optimize images for better speed. Keep your database clean and remove unused transients. A fast best WooCommerce upsell plugin setup improves conversions.
- Upsell recommendations feel random or not useful for buyers. Fix the targeting rules and match offers to cart intent. Use same category, same brand, or same product type rules. Avoid showing expensive upgrades without clear value differences. Use simple bundles that feel natural and logical. A WooCommerce product upsell plugin works best with relevant offers.
- Upsell acceptance works, but revenue is not tracked correctly. Check if tracking is enabled inside the plugin settings. Confirm your analytics setup is working on checkout pages. Verify that thank you page tracking is not blocked. Some cache plugins can block scripts and event tracking. Test using a real order and confirm report updates afterward. This helps measure the best upsell plugin for WooCommerce results.
- Payment gateway issues with post-purchase one-click upsells. One-click offers need proper gateway support and token handling. Confirm the plugin supports your gateway for one-click upsells. Update the payment gateway plugin to the latest stable version. Test in staging to avoid customer facing payment failures. If needed, switch gateway mode settings for better support. This makes your WooCommerce upsell and cross sell plugin flow safer.
- Plugin conflicts with other sales or discount plugins. Discounts can break offer pricing if rules overlap badly. Disable other funnel, popup, or cart plugins for testing. Check if coupon rules are overriding your upsell pricing logic. Use one primary upsell plugin WooCommerce tool to avoid conflicts. Keep the offer logic clean and avoid stacking too many rules.
- Mobile view looks broken for upsell blocks and offers. Check responsive settings in the plugin layout options. Reduce long titles and large images inside offer blocks. Use simple layouts with fewer columns for mobile screens. Test on real devices and adjust spacing carefully. A clean layout helps the best upsell plugin for WooCommerce perform better.
Conclusion
Choosing the best upsell plugin for WooCommerce depends on your store goal. If you want funnels, focus on post-purchase and order bumps. If you want simple offers, focus on product and cart upsells. Always choose a WooCommerce upsell plugin with clean targeting rules. Test your offers and keep them helpful for buyers. Use upgrades that feel natural and improve customer value. Keep the setup simple and avoid too many offers at once. This improves trust and keeps the checkout flow smooth. With the right best WooCommerce upsell plugin, your sales can grow steadily.
Need help choosing the best upsell plugin for WooCommerce and setting it up fast? Contact woohelpdesk and we will optimize your WooCommerce upsell plugin for higher sales and better conversions.

